Preschool Backpack Must-Haves
Keep your preschooler’s backpack light but functional by including:
- A spill-proof water bottle with their name clearly labeled
- An extra set of weather-appropriate clothes
- A comfort item for naptime (like a soft toy or small blanket)
- Any daily forms, artwork, or notes to pass along to teachers
Packing only the essentials prevents the backpack from becoming too heavy and keeps things simple for little learners.
Building Independence Through Packing
Involving your preschooler in the packing process builds confidence. Let them tuck their comfort item in a pocket, or choose their extra shirt. These small tasks foster a sense of ownership over their daily routine.
A Simple Packing Routine
Creating a consistent morning and evening routine around their backpack helps preschoolers feel prepared. Set a habit of packing the night before, then reviewing everything together in the morning. This builds responsibility while reinforcing memory skills.
